我遇到了这个可视化,其中有一个圆圈,圆圈上有数据点,圆圈上的点之间有内部线(弧线或边缘)。这种可视化的名称是什么?
我如何从像下面这样的二维表中生成它?我希望圆上的点 A、B、C、D 和 E 以及从点 i 到 j 的值是它们之间的弧。像d3.js能够生成它的东西吗?
d3.js
这是一个和弦图。它通常是从像您所拥有的那样的方阵中生成的。这可以通过至少在 R(circlize包)和 Python(plotly)中的特定库来完成。使用 d3.js也可以做到这一点,但显然不是那么容易。
一般建议:我发现“X Graph Gallery”网站非常方便探索不同类型的图表:R 图表库、Python 图表库和D3 图表库。